Let 4theta + 10degrees = 2x

#

if we look at what we are given in part a

#

we know that cosec2x + cot2x = cotx

#

hence cosec(4theta + 10) + cot(4theta + 10) = cot(2theta+5)

#

hence we can rewrite our equation as:

#

cot(2theta + 5 degrees) = sqrt(3)

#

cot = 1/tan(angle)

#

hence 1/tan(2theta + 5 degrees) = sqrt(3)

#

hence 1/sqrt(3) = tan(2theta+5)

#

arctan(1/sqrt3) = 30, 210 (although 210 is more than 180 we will still test to see if theta is less than 180)

#

our first equation will be 30 = 2theta + 5 hence theta = 12.5

#

our second equation will be (210 -5)/2 =102.5 = theta

#

if we want to test another value

#

just add 180 to 210 (period of tan)

#

390 = 2theta + 5

#

hence 385/2 = theta

#

sadly this is 192.5 which is out our range

#

no need to test any values less than 30 because they will be negative (-150) which will give us a negative theta which we dont want
